A problem that I had discovered was that when applying a collider with a particle emitter for allowing a particle material to react with objects; such as sparks bouncing off the walls. This only works when you apply it around geometry as opposed to a static mesh so it was difficult to make my particles react with its surrounding objects because the building is a static mesh.
